Remarks

THE GOOD PART The college has a good reputation overall. As compared to other colleges it has better faculties. In 2017 St. Xavier's College was one of the few autonomous colleges in Mumbai(Now many more ave become autonomous). The best part of St. Xavier's is that you will have students coming from all over India over here, thus there is diversity in culture. Apart from academics, you will build many soft skills over here such as communication skills, leadership etc. Batch size is small so the bonding with professors is very good. You can contact them at any time, they are very supportive. It is a very inclusive campus so you will never feel left alone over here. Sports and Extracurricular activities are supported a lot at Xavier's. THE DOWNSIDES If you are someone scoring in higher 90s and expecting a lot (academically) then you might get a bit disappointed. The syllabus is not very rigorous and not much research takes place. However, you will be encouraged if you want to.

Course Curriculum Overview

3.5

The course curriculum is not very rigorous. The curriculum is neither an application-oriented one. The curriculum is a simple research/academics oriented curriculum. However, the college will arrange for courses, workshops and guest lectures for you to enhance your application skills of the subject. FACULTY The student-faculty ratio varies from year to year and subject to subject. It may range from 1:60 to 1:30 for statistics. The student-professor bonding is very good over here. The faculties are very supportive, friendly and liberal. You can contact the faculty whenever you want to. Qualification: All of them have at least a masters degree. Some hold MPhil and PhD qualification. EXAMS there are 2 in-term exams and one final exam every semester. The questions asked in the exams are from whatever is taught in the classroom. It is not difficult to pass statistics exams. Hardly 1-2 students have KT in statistics. Few students get KT in Maths papers which they easily clear afterwards

Internships Opportunities

3

The college placement cell will provide details of various internships available. However, companies do not come over to the college to hire interns. You will have to apply and get an internship by yourself. The placement cell will provide assistance with the same.

Placement Experience

4.5

The college has a placement cell. Many reputed companies like McKinsey, EY, Citi Bank, Bain, PwC, AT Kerney, Times Internet etc visit the campus every year for placements. Highest package is around INR 15 LPA(ATKerney & Citi Bank), Avg around 5 LPA and lowest around 3 LPA. (Numbers are not official numbers). 30-40% of students who sit for placement get placed (This is my observation, not official numbers) Some students choose to go abroad to pursue their masters. I continued masters within India.

Fees and Financial Aid

The BSc course is an Aided course and thus the fees are nominal. The fees may vary from 5000 to 9000 per year depending upon subject and year of study. Scholarship opportunities from the Government will be displayed on the notice board. The college has a student beneficiary fund to help the needful and deserving students. The college provided financial assistance to one of my friend in my batch. The college has no on-campus job for students with a stipend for financial help. Hostel and living expenses will be higher as the college is located in the southern part of Mumbai where real estate rates are very high. Fees like is usually 5-8% annually (This is based on my observation, there is no prescribed policy for fees hike)

Campus Life

5

The college will definitely rank in the top 10 in India in this aspect. CAMPUS AND INFRASTRUCTURE The campus is not too big but the structure is magnificent. You can see the college in many movies and TV series (Vaaste song, Hichki, Kabir Singh, Sacred Games and many more). There are adequate facilities on campus. One of the major downsides is that we don't have a big dedicated sports ground. The Quadrangle is available for playing sports but there are restrictions. SOCIAL LIFE & EXTRACURRICULARS You will have the best social life over here. There are at least 5-6 fests in college every year( Including malhar: google it out). There are many clubs run by students- Social service league, AICUF, DIRS are few of them. Every department has their own club (Stats society, Eco circle etc). Sports is also supported a lot here, we have a sports day every year. You can check my Quora for more info as I have run out of word limit, and the list is endless

Interview Experience

5

There is a counselling session for assigning the desired subject combination and in-person verification of the student and documents. No subject related questions or personal questions are asked in this counselling session.
